Hello. Glad you liked the video. I thought I mentioned the bearing size but just reviewed the video and it appears I forgot that! The bearings are 0.125 inches diameter (3.17mm). Thanks!
Thanks for the video! Very helpful. One question though, could I do this while the freewheel is mounted on the wheel? It seems that it is possible, I would like to avoid purchasing the tool for only this one time overhaul. Thanks!
Absolutely! This is an excellent question I didn’t address in the video. You’ll need a second chain whip tool to hold the freewheel while you loosen the two smaller cogs with the other one. You’ll be able to disassemble normally from there. Have fun!

I believe so, but it would be limited to 4 usable "speeds" because the two smallest cogs are machined together and the spacing cant be changed between them to be compatible with 7 speed indexed shifters. You'd have to find spacers that make the cog to cog spacing 5.0mm instead of the current 5.5mm and you'd also have to put a spacer on the inside of the largest cog since you are shrinking the overall width. The two smallest cogs screw onto the body and compress all the cogs and spacers to keep them tight. Hope this helps.
If you look at the video starting at 2:30, I mention needing a special freewheel tool to remove it from the rear wheel hub. It is Bicycle Research part number CT-3. You can leave it on the rear wheel hub if you want, but you need two chainwhip tools. One to hold the freewheel from spinning and one to unscrew the two small cogs from the freewheel body.
